Skip to main content

ETH to SOL cross-chain swap: an all-in fixed quote straight into Solana

Ethereum to Solana cross-ecosystem swap. UpSwap's quote-matching engine polls multiple routes in real time — the quote is what you receive, no KYC

Moving from ETH to SOL no longer means a CEX deposit-and-withdraw detour. UpSwap locks an all-in fixed quote before you submit the order and completes the cross-chain swap in 4 steps — no wallet connection, no custody of your assets, no privacy exposure. The go-to entry route for Sol meme traders, Solana DeFi users and cross-ecosystem newcomers: funds are automatically refunded to the source address on failure, and SOL lands in your Solana address within 30 minutes.

You sendEthereum
You receiveSolana
0
Best rateEst. 60 secAll-in fixed quoteAuto refund on failure

ETH (Ethereum mainnet) → SOL (Solana mainnet): pain points of traditional methods and how UpSwap solves them

Pain points

  • CEX deposits are so slow the meme has already doubled

    On-chain Solana markets move in seconds, while CEX deposit confirmations plus withdrawal risk reviews routinely take 30 minutes to several hours. By the time your SOL arrives, the meme coin you wanted has already mooned or gone to zero — the golden window is gone.

  • EVM wallets can't hold SOL directly

    EVM wallets like MetaMask and Rabby don't support the Solana address format. Newcomers often don't realize they need a separate Phantom wallet, and SOL sent to an EVM address by mistake is simply gone.

  • Bridge aggregator slippage eats into your principal

    Traditional bridges quote an estimate, not a final price. Actual execution gets hit by gas swings, pool depth and stacked slippage — a few hundred dollars of ETH routinely arrives as 3% to 5% less SOL, and larger orders fare even worse.

  • Wallet-signing phishing can drain everything

    Most bridges require a MetaMask connection and contract approvals with murky permission scopes. Plenty of users have had an entire wallet drained after signing a single swap — and cross-ecosystem users unfamiliar with Solana contracts are even easier targets.

  • CEX onboarding means KYC and review queues

    Binance, OKX and Coinbase have tightened risk controls in recent years. Opening an account means submitting ID documents and waiting on reviews — a long detour when all you want is a one-off swap into SOL.

How UpSwap solves it

  • Fixed quote locked, SOL arrives within 30 minutes

    UpSwap's quote-matching engine polls multiple routing networks in real time; the winning quote is the exact amount you receive, locked the moment you submit the order. Once the ETH transaction confirms on-chain, SOL typically arrives in 5-30 minutes — fast enough to catch a meme run.

  • Paste a Phantom / Solflare receiving address directly

    All you provide at order time is your Solana address (Phantom, Solflare or Backpack all work). UpSwap validates the address format up front, ruling out EVM-address mistakes at the source.

  • The quote is what arrives — no hidden slippage

    The SOL amount shown on the page is exactly the amount you receive; the quote-matching layer absorbs routing costs, slippage and gas swings. What you see is what you get. On failure, your ETH is automatically refunded to the source address — no service fee, only the refund transfer's on-chain gas is deducted.

  • No wallet connection, no approvals, ever

    UpSwap runs a non-custodial send-and-receive flow: you send ETH to our designated deposit address, and we send SOL to your Solana address. No MetaMask connection, no contract approvals — the phishing surface drops to zero.

  • No sign-up, no KYC

    No email registration and no ID documents. Open the page and complete the ETH to SOL swap in 4 steps — available out of the box in supported regions (see the Terms of Service for restricted jurisdictions).

4 ways to swap ETH (Ethereum mainnet) to SOL (Solana mainnet), compared

A side-by-side look at the 4 mainstream ways to swap ETH for SOL, rated on settlement speed, privacy requirements and total cost. Comparison covers Binance / OKX (CEX), Changelly / ChangeNOW / FixedFloat (aggregators), and Uniswap / Jupiter (DEX).

Method Cost Time Sign-up Pros / cons
UpSwap (quote-matching engine) All-in fixed quote — the quote is what arrives, no hidden slippage Arrives in 5-30 minutes No KYC, no wallet connection, no sign-up Pros: direct cross-ecosystem route, automatic refund to the source address on failure, Phantom address validation. Cons: large orders need splitting
CEX deposit-and-withdraw (Binance / OKX / Bybit) Deposit/withdrawal fees plus network fees; big-exchange spread costs tens of dollars more 30 minutes to several hours (risk reviews vary) Mandatory KYC; hard to onboard from restricted regions Pros: deep liquidity. Cons: KYC, review delays, missed meme windows
Bridge aggregators (LI.FI / Socket / Squid) Estimated quotes; actual slippage runs 1-5% 10-40 minutes, route-dependent No KYC Pros: transparent routing. Cons: wallet connection and approvals required, price not locked, contract risk
Non-KYC swaps (Changelly / ChangeNOW / FixedFloat) Quotes often carry floating rates; the amount received can differ from the quote 15-60 minutes No KYC Pros: no sign-up. Cons: most don't lock the price, and refunds on failure are slow

ETH (Ethereum mainnet) → SOL (Solana mainnet) FAQ

How long does an ETH to SOL swap take?

From the moment your ETH reaches UpSwap's deposit address and collects enough Ethereum mainnet confirmations, SOL typically lands in your Phantom address within 5 to 30 minutes. The main variables are Ethereum mainnet congestion and gas levels — Solana itself usually settles within tens of seconds. If nothing has arrived after 60 minutes, contact Telegram @upswapservice for a fast order lookup.

How are fees calculated? Is there any hidden slippage?

UpSwap uses an all-in fixed quote: the SOL amount shown on the page is exactly the amount that arrives. The quote-matching layer has already absorbed routing fees, slippage, gas swings, cross-chain spread and every other variable — no hidden slippage, no haggling step. On failure, your ETH is automatically refunded to the source address — no service fee, only the refund transfer's on-chain gas is deducted.

Do I need to connect MetaMask or any other wallet?

No. UpSwap runs a non-custodial send-and-receive flow: you simply send ETH manually from your own wallet to a temporary deposit address we generate, and provide a SOL receiving address (Phantom, Solflare or Backpack all work). No wallet extension is invoked, no contract approval is requested, and your private keys are never touched.

Is KYC or an account required?

No. UpSwap requires no account and no ID documents — open the page and start the swap directly. UpSwap does not provide services to restricted jurisdictions; see the Terms of Service for the current list.

What if I enter the wrong SOL receiving address?

Once the SOL transfer is initiated after you submit the order, it cannot be reversed. So double-check your Solana address before ordering (Base58 format — not a 0x EVM address); UpSwap validates the format in the front end to catch obvious mistakes. If the address is valid but isn't your own wallet, the SOL goes to someone else's account and cannot be recovered, so verify carefully.

How are failed orders refunded? Is a fee deducted?

If an order fails to fill — expired quote, amount too small, above the maximum and so on — UpSwap automatically refunds the ETH to your paying address. No service fee is charged on refunds; only the on-chain gas of the refund transfer (usually 0.5-5 USD equivalent) is deducted from the refund amount. For anything unusual, contact Telegram @upswapservice or support@upswap.io for a manual fast track.

How much ETH can I swap per order? What are the minimum and maximum?

The minimum and maximum are shown live on the quote page; they depend on current routing-pool depth and market liquidity in the quote-matching layer, with no fixed ceiling. For large ETH to SOL orders, splitting into 2 to 3 consecutive orders usually gets better quotes, or contact support for an OTC quote.

How do I spot phishing sites and fake support?

UpSwap support responds only via Telegram @upswapservice and support@upswap.io. We never add you as a friend first, never ask you to sign any contract, and never request a seed phrase. Verify the official domain in the browser address bar before ordering. Anyone demanding a "security deposit", "unfreezing fee" or "tax payment" is a scammer — block them and never transfer.

Other popular swap routes

Start your ETH (Ethereum mainnet) → SOL (Solana mainnet) swap now

Done in 4 steps — no sign-up, no wallet connection, what you see is what you get. Questions? Telegram @upswapservice responds in real time.